MERV 13 vs HEPA Filters: Best Choice for Wildfire Smoke?

Wildfire smoke brings bad things like PM2.5, soot, and ash. These tiny bits easily get inside homes and offices through air vents.

Are you picking between MERV 13 and HEPA? The right choice depends on how big the dust is. It also depends on how thick the smoke is, how hard your fan blows, and what your system can handle.

What Is MERV 13?

MERV grades use the ASHRAE 52.2 test rules. MERV 13 filters catch most dirt sizes from 1 to 10 microns. They do a good job blocking normal dust, pollen, and big pieces of ash. But they struggle a bit with super tiny things. When facing dirt around 0.3 micron, they only stop about 60% to 85% during standard tests.

Where Does MERV 13 Fit?

A MERV 13 filter lets air flow through pretty easily. So, it fits nicely into most central HVAC units without needing new parts. It also costs less money. You can just swap it out like normal.

When fires are small, it cuts down the smoke inside. But if the smoke gets really thick, use it as an early pre-filter. A folded MERV 13 catches big ash first. This keeps your next filters completely safe.

What Is an H13 or H14 HEPA Filter?

The EN 1822 rule sorts filters by the trickiest dirt they face. An H13 HEPA grabs at least 99.95% of test dust. The stronger H14 kind gets at least 99.995%. This super-fine cleaning is perfect for PM2.5. It traps tiny soot and smoke bits. These are the exact things that slip right past weaker filters.

What Are the Trade-Offs?

HEPA paper blocks the air much more than MERV 13. Because of this, you might need a stronger fan. You might also need a bigger filter box or a whole new air machine.

Also, HEPA cannot clear away bad gases like carbon monoxide. You must add an activated carbon filter to catch harmful gas fumes.

How Do MERV 13 and HEPA Compare?

Index MERV 13 Filter H13/H14 HEPA Filter
Standard Basis ASHRAE 52.2 EN 1822:2009
Approx. 0.3 Micron Efficiency 60%–85% ≥99.95%
Best For Daily dust and big ash Fine smoke and PM2.5
Air Resistance Low Medium to high
Typical Use Main HVAC vents Cleanrooms and smoke units

Which Setup Fits Your Smoke Scenario?

Your building type and the amount of smoke help you pick. Always check your fan power and filter size first. A great filter fails completely if dirty air sneaks around its frame.

Commercial Buildings

Try mixing them together for big HVAC vents. Put a MERV 13 pre-filter right in front of an H13 main filter. The first one grabs big ash and heavy dust. Then, the HEPA handles any leftover fine smoke. This combo stops the final filter from clogging too fast. It saves you time on fixes.

Residential Air Conditioning

MERV 13 is a smart, simple upgrade for normal homes. It cuts down indoor smoke when fires are small. Just make sure to change it early if it looks dirty or if the air stops blowing hard.

Hospitals, Labs, and Industrial Workshops

Places dealing with thick smoke need extra help. They use separate H13 or H14 systems with strong fan rules. If smelly or toxic fumes are around, put HEPA together with activated carbon. Always follow the local air safety rules.

FAQ

Q1: Is MERV 13 effective against wildfire smoke?
A: It blocks a lot of large dust. But it is weaker than HEPA when stopping 0.3 micron things.

Q2: Is H13 better than MERV 13 for PM2.5?
A: Yes. H13 scores much higher on tests for grabbing tiny dirt.

Q3: Can HEPA remove wildfire gas pollutants?
A: No. You must add activated carbon to trap nasty gases and smells.

Q4: Should you use MERV 13 before HEPA?
A: Yes, most times. It grabs heavy ash early. This helps the HEPA part last longer.

Q5: Which filter is best for wildfire air quality?
A: It really depends on the smoke. MERV 13 gives good basic safety. Pick H13/H14 when the smoke gets super heavy.
